Chemical & Reference Data

The following specifications are compiled from publicly available scientific databases and peer-reviewed literature for laboratory reference.

Property Value
Compound Class Synthetic long-acting GHRH analogue incorporating a Drug Affinity Complex (DAC) for albumin binding
Molecular Formula C152H252N44O42
Molecular Weight 3367.9 g/mol
CAS Registry Number 863288-34-0
Amino Acid Residues 30
Sequence Modified GHRH(1-29) containing D-Ala², Gln⁸, Ala¹⁵, Leu²⁷ and Lys³⁰(MPA) substitutions
Mechanism GHRH receptor agonist with prolonged circulation through albumin binding
Reported Half-Life Approximately 6–8 days in published human studies
Solubility Reconstitutes in bacteriostatic water for laboratory applications
Lyophilised Storage Stable at 2–8°C for 24 months or longer
Reconstituted Storage Store at 2–8°C and use within 30 days
Regulatory Status Investigational research compound

CJC-1295 (with DAC) is a synthetic analogue of growth hormone-releasing hormone (GHRH) incorporating a Drug Affinity Complex (DAC). The maleimide-linked DAC modification enables binding to serum albumin, resulting in an extended circulating half-life as described in published research. It is supplied as a lyophilised powder intended exclusively for in-vitro laboratory research.
